摘要
Provided are a phosphorescent material which is excellent in horizontal orientation and the like when a thin film is formed, a process for efficiently producing the phosphorescent material, and a light emitting element using the phosphorescent material.;The present invention provides a phosphorescent material represented by the following general formula (1), a process for producing the phosphorescent material, and a light emitting element using the phosphorescent material, wherein the phosphorescent material has a straight-chain conjugated structure, a 2-phenylpyridine ligand, a central metal and a β-diketone-type ligand,;In the general formula (1), end substituents R1 and R2 each is a hydrogen atom, an alkyl group having 1 to 20 carbon atoms, or the like, substituents a to l and o to s each is a hydrogen atom or the like, the central metal M is platinum or the like, and repetition numbers m and n each is an integer of 0 to 4.
